I need a slide stop for a S&W 1076. I've had one on back order from Midway for over a year and Gun Parts corp shows them as out of stock. Any other good sources of 3rd gen parts I should try?
Parts kits come up fairly often for similar calibers: Have seen for a 10mm (s'been a while) more common for 59 or 45 series. Usually have slide stop (amazing how expensive/rare those durn things are). Look at Numrich to figure out which is common for 10mm.

Recently I needed a part for one of my 3rd generation gun. The 6906 needed a new right decocking lever. I called S&W and they mailed one to me. They still service them and parts are available.
